Axis Connector Power Source
Each Axis (and Auxiliary Encoder) connector has a n5 VDC power
source to aid application installations. The power source typically is used to
power:
•
An external encoder, and
•
Optical inputs and/or outputs between the ACR9000/ACR9030 and an
external drive.
Table 12 contains the electrical characteristics for the Axis-Connector power
source. Figure 1 provides a schematic of its circuit.

1. Maximum current draw per Axis/Encoder Connector is 250 mA, not to exceed a combined
1500 mA for eight axis connectors and two auxiliary encoder connectors.

Axis-Connector Fuse
The Axis connector has a +5V voltage source for powering an encoder
and/or drive I/O, and includes a fuse, as shown in Figure 8 above. In the
event the +5V source shorts to ground, the internal reset-able fuse disables
the +5V source. When the short-circuit condition is removed and the fuse
cools, the fuse automatically resets.
